## Circuit Breaker Tuning

The Ferrow gateway wraps every call to the upstream Quillard pricing API in a circuit breaker. When the rolling error rate crosses the trip threshold, the breaker opens and requests fail fast with a cached quote. After the cooldown, a limited number of probe requests test recovery before the breaker fully closes. These values were tuned during the Halewick load tests and rarely need changing; if you do adjust them, update the runbook too. The current settings are listed below.

tuning table, tafog-hadug:
THRESHOLDS = {
    "novath": 282,
    "ulaok": 770,
    "julath": 545,
    "keliel": 909,
    "joreth": 37,
}

## Changelog — 2024.31

- Shipped the Burrowell dedup pass for customer records. Merges exact-email and fuzzy-name duplicates across the Kestrelbay and Fenwick imports; ~41k records collapsed in the first run.
- Merge decisions logged to the audit stream; reversals possible for 30 days.
- Known gap: households sharing an address are sometimes over-merged; fix queued for next sprint.
- Questions, rollback requests, or threshold tuning go to the dedup pipeline owner, named below.

named custodian: Brivan Eliath Quenox Frador

Runbook: Sableguard Typo-Squat Scanner. The scanner compares every newly published package name in the Fernhollow registry against our approved dependency list, flagging edit-distance matches and homoglyph substitutions. Review each flagged entry carefully: confirm the publisher, inspect install scripts, and record your verdict before quarantining. False positives are common with scoped forks. The full reviewer criteria and escalation matrix live on the page below.

runbook for tafof-yawif: https://confluence.tolvaqsys.internal/display/display/browse/pages/7be3

Handover note — from Director Ellan Marsh to Director Tobin Creel. Quick rundown on the Verro Systems licensing dispute: their counsel claims our Quillpoint module breaches their template licence. We disagree, and outside counsel at Harrowden Legal backs us, but settlement talks are live. Heads of department — hold any new Quillpoint deployments until this clears. Tobin owns next steps. Confidential plan note sits just below.

confidential, kagep-kahof: Druokax Systems plans to lower the Ulaath list price by 53 percent in March.